Enhancing The Learning Experience: The Rise Of Teacher-Friendly EdTech

In recent years, there has been a significant shift towards incorporating technology into the educational sector. With the advent of various educational technologies (edtech), teachers have been able to enhance their teaching methodologies and create more engaging and interactive learning environments for students. However, not all edtech solutions are created equal. Some can be overly complex, time-consuming, or simply not conducive to the classroom setting. This is where the concept of “teacher-friendly edtech” comes into play.

teacher-friendly edtech refers to educational technologies that are specifically designed to meet the needs and preferences of educators. These technologies are easy to use, intuitive, and seamlessly integrate into the existing curriculum without causing disruptions. They aim to streamline the teaching process, save time, and improve the overall learning experience for both teachers and students.

One of the key features of teacher-friendly edtech is its user-friendly interface. Teachers do not have the time or patience to fumble through complex software or tools. They need solutions that are straightforward, easy to navigate, and require minimal training. With teacher-friendly edtech, educators can quickly adapt to the technology and focus on what really matters – teaching.

Another important aspect of teacher-friendly edtech is its flexibility and adaptability. Every classroom is unique, and teachers need tools that can be customized to suit their specific needs and teaching styles. Whether it’s creating interactive lessons, organizing student data, or facilitating collaboration, teacher-friendly edtech offers a range of versatile features that can be tailored to individual requirements.

Moreover, teacher-friendly edtech is designed to be time-saving. Teachers already have a multitude of responsibilities and tasks to juggle on a daily basis. The last thing they need is technology that adds to their workload. teacher-friendly edtech automates repetitive tasks, provides instant feedback, and simplifies complex processes, allowing teachers to focus on delivering high-quality instruction and engaging with their students.

One prime example of teacher-friendly edtech is Google Classroom. This platform has become a staple in many classrooms due to its user-friendly interface, seamless integration with Google Apps, and collaborative features. With Google Classroom, teachers can create and organize assignments, provide feedback, communicate with students, and track progress – all in one centralized location. This simplifies the teaching process and fosters a more efficient and interactive learning environment.

Another excellent example of teacher-friendly edtech is Kahoot! This interactive game-based learning platform allows teachers to create quizzes, surveys, and discussions to engage students in a fun and educational way. With Kahoot!, teachers can assess student understanding, promote teamwork, and generate real-time feedback, all while keeping students motivated and active participants in their own learning.

Furthermore, Edpuzzle is a great tool for creating interactive video lessons. Teachers can upload videos, add questions, insights and track student progress. This makes learning more engaging and ensures that students are actively involved in the learning process. Educational technologies like Edpuzzle make it easier for teachers to create personalized and interactive lessons that cater to different learning styles and abilities.
